December is a solid shoulder-season month to visit Mammoth Cave National Park: crowds run 29% of the July peak (28,745 average visits), days average 51°F with 9.6 hours of daylight. Computed from NPS and NOAA data.

Crowds in December

Mammoth Cave averages 28,745 recreation visits in December — 29% of what July, the peak month, draws — the third-quietest month of the year. Trailheads and parking fill accordingly.

Weather & daylight

Days are cool (highs average 51°F), and mornings are chilly (lows average 33°F). This is one of the wetter months (4.8″ of precipitation on average). Mid-month daylight runs 9.6 hours.

NOAA 1991–2020 monthly normals, station MAMMOTH CAVE, KY US (4 mi from park coordinates, 760 ft elevation) — conditions vary inside the park, especially with elevation. Daylight computed for the 15th of December.
